About Thomas G. Meikle
Thomas G. Meikle is a scholar working on Microbiology, Analytical Chemistry and Molecular Medicine, having authored 29 papers that have together received 786 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Lipid Membrane Structure and Behavior (13 papers), Protein Structure and Dynamics (6 papers) and NMR spectroscopy and applications (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Microbiology (130 citations), Molecular Medicine (48 citations) and Pharmaceutical Science (58 citations). Thomas G. Meikle has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, United States and Switzerland. Frequent co-authors include Charlotte E. Conn, Calum J. Drummond, Frances Separovic, Cuihua Chang, Alexandru Zabara, Peter J. Meikle, Corey Giles, Kevin Huynh, Jamie Strachan and Brendan Dyett. Their work appears in journals such as Nature Communications, The Journal of Chemical Physics and S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ología.
